Utility knives are among the most versatile tools for tradespeople and hobbyists alike, offering a compact form factor that handles a surprising range of materials with clean, precise cuts. The key to picking the right knife starts with understanding blade geometry, blade material, and the mechanism that holds the blade securely during tough tasks. For construction sites, you want a knife that can rapidly switch blades, stand up to daily wear, and resist corrosion from job-site solvents and dust. Ergonomics also matter, as extended use should not lead to fatigue or strain. A well-chosen knife becomes an extension of the worker’s hand, delivering consistent results every time.
When evaluating blade types, the most common choices are retractable utility blades, replaceable blades, and snap-off blades. Retractable models provide safety against accidental contact and are ideal for tasks requiring frequent stopping and starting. Replaceable blade knives typically offer robust construction and longer-lasting edges, suitable for heavy-duty materials. Snap-off blades excel at quick length adjustments and staggered edge life, which can be a cost saver over time. The blade count and locking mechanism influence cutting control and safety. A model with a sturdy locking blade and a comfortable, textured handle will reduce slippage in dusty environments and provide the predictability needed for precise cuts in carpentry, drywall, and flooring installations.

Ergonomics extend far beyond comfort, shaping how steadily you can guide the knife through material. Look for contoured grips that fit the hand without causing hot spots, and consider scales or finger grooves that promote a secure hold when wearing work gloves. Weight distribution matters as well; a well-balanced knife reduces wrist fatigue during long sessions of trimming and scoring. Some models incorporate rubberized or textured surfaces to prevent slipping on slick materials like fiberglass or sealed plywood panels. The tang or frame should feel reinforced, especially in environments with frequent impacts from unintended drops. A good knife remains controllable under pressure, not just when new.
Maintenance and blade-changing speed influence overall productivity more than many users expect. Choose tools with magnetic blade cavities or quick-release mechanisms to minimize downtime. Keeping spare blades on hand reduces trips to the toolbox and keeps projects moving. Clean your knife after exposure to plaster dust, solvents, or cutting lubricants to prevent corrosion and blade dulling. A blade-locking system should stay secure through vibrations from saws or impact chisels. Inspect the knife body for cracks or bent metal after heavy use, and replace worn components promptly. Investing in a reliable knife with simple maintenance routines pays dividends in accuracy and lifespan.

For drywall finishing, precision is essential. A knife designed with a low-profile blade and a slim spine allows you to score and trim joint compound with minimal drama, leaving seamless seams and a professional finish. Some models feature anti-snag edges that prevent catching on uneven drywall paper, reducing tear-out and rework. When choosing for finishing work, consider blades with hardened tips that resist chipping when cutting through tough joints or fiberglass mesh. In these environments, a comfortable grip and vibration damping can prevent fatigue during long taping sessions. Durability and precise alignment of the blade are especially important in edge work around ceilings.
For flooring installation, accurately cutting vinyl, carpet, or foam underlayment requires a knife that won’t warp or wander. A blade profile designed for smooth scoring helps you create straight lines without tearing or fraying. Some tools offer adjustable blade depth, enabling you to tailor the cut to the material’s thickness and rigidity. A knife with a robust locking mechanism will keep the blade aligned even when you lean into a cut. It’s also practical to choose a model with a quick-change blade system so you can switch blades without slowing the workflow during layout and trimming. Ergonomics matter again here to avoid hand cramps during long flooring sessions.

When tackling cardboard or thin plastics, the preferred blade is one with a finer edge and a smoother glide. The knife should maintain a consistent bite without tearing the material. Some designs include a shield to protect the thumb while you apply pressure, reducing the risk of accidental nicks. Consider whether you need a side-locking feature or a top-locking variant; each offers different feedback to the user during cuts. A sturdy body that resists flex ensures that the knife will not bend mid-stroke, which can ruin a cut line. For storage, look for cases or belt holsters that keep the knife secure yet accessible.
Construction sites often demand a balance between rigidity and flexibility. A heavy-duty tool with reinforced scales can withstand the rigors of framing, insulation, and sheetrock work. In addition to blade quality, think about the overall design that supports comfortable handling in varied postures—standing, kneeling, or reaching overhead. Some utility knives integrate belt clip or lanyard attachment points to prevent loss during chaotic days. If you frequently work with metal foil or painter’s tape, a knife that accommodates specialty blades can save time and reduce the risk of accidental cuts. Finally, ensure the blade change system is intuitive so you can keep moving without interruptions.

For intricate trim work, a knife that delivers fine control and precision is essential. A narrow blade or a knife with a shallow bevel lets you follow profiles and achieve tight radii in wood inlay or moulding. A locking mechanism that stays firm when pressure is applied ensures that the blade does not skew or chatter. Look for a tang-reinforced frame that resists bending, particularly when you’re working against a thick baseboard or corner bead. A high-visibility blade exchange indicator helps you know when a blade is due for replacement, avoiding the compromise of a dull edge on delicate trim tasks. Ergonomics again influence accuracy in small, detailed cuts.
Finishing work benefits from a knife that couples blade stability with a smooth cutting experience. Some models feature low-friction coatings to reduce blade drag and heat buildup during extended use. A well-designed knife should allow for rapid blade changes without disassembling the handle, which is crucial for time-sensitive projects like cabinet refinishing. The ability to lock the blade in multiple positions enhances versatility for different cut angles. When selecting, consider how you store spare blades and how easily you can transport the tool with blades inserted. A practical knife becomes a reliable partner in all stages of finishing.
Beyond the blade, the handle construction influences how safely and efficiently you work. A good handle distributes pressure across the palm and fingers, reducing hotspots that lead to fatigue. Rubberized or textured surfaces improve grip in wet or dusty conditions, common on job sites. Some models incorporate ergonomic finger guards that protect the hand during aggressive cuts, a small but meaningful safety feature. Consider the overall balance of the knife when selecting; a tool that feels top-heavy or awkward can hinder your accuracy. Also assess the compatibility with gloves, because worn gloves should not compromise tactile feedback or grip.
Finally, choose a knife with a strong warranty and reliable supplier support. A solid warranty reflects that the manufacturer stands behind the product, which matters when you’re relying on a blade for daily work. Look for models with replaceable parts and readily available blades to minimize downtime. Reviews and field reports can reveal how the knife performs under heat, dust, and rough handling. In practical terms, invest in a few blades of varying profiles to handle different materials and finishes. By aligning blade type, handle ergonomics, and maintenance accessibility, you’ll select a utility knife that consistently improves your workflow across construction, DIY, and finishing tasks.
